“Bayberry Cafe is packing up their Woburn bags and relocating to Cambridge. Their last day of service will be Mothers Day (May 14) 2023. Their new location will be called Ramen O Bowl and will be at: 1668 Massachusetts Ave Cambridge MA with an opening in the near future. Bayberry has been a wonderful community restaurant since they opened 6 years ago, bringing some of the most delicious vegan food to the North suburbs, but unfortunately it is their time to give another location a try.“
